Hi everyone. In response to the new dialysis conditions for coverage, the Council of Nephrology Social Workers invites you to save the date
 
Friday May 16, 2008
 
12-2pm central

"CNSW Presents: The 2008 Conditions for Dialysis Coverage- Psychosocial Considerations"


for a webinar on the new conditions for coverage for dialysis. This is the first in a series that the CNSW Committee on the New Conditions for Dialysis Coverage will put together to help you figure out what the new conditions, which will take effect in six months, mean to you and your social work practice. This will be a basic review of psychosocial aspects of the new conditions.

We encourage local chapters to arrange meetings on that date, if you are able to huddle around a computer screen to watch the slides and put the verbal information on speaker phone, so you can then discuss them afterwards, OR we will make this presentation available to local chapter chairs, like we did with the Jan. State of CNSW Webinar.

We will provide you with the link to sign up and phone # closer to the date. You will need to have access to the internet, and a phone line to particpate.
